ACE Students Attend Legislative Day

Five Missouri Valley ACE students attended the Iowa Association of Alternative Education (IAAE) Legislative Day at the Capitol in Des Moines on Monday, February 14, 2011.  They joined numerous alternative schools and programs from across Iowa in setting up table displays showcasing their programs and drawing attention to the importance of having alternative education options available to students.  The students were able to meet other students and teachers and learn about other alternative schools and programs from across the state.

The highlight of the day was having Governor Branstad address the students about the importance of education and the realization that "one size does not fit all" when it comes to education.  The students also took a guided tour of the Capitol building learning about it's rich history.  Click here to view Governor Branstad's address to the students.
